Catie Hoch lost her battle with cancer on May 18th, 2000. She touched the hearts of everyone she met. She has two younger brothers, Robby age 10 and Johnny age 7.

We have set up the Catie Hoch Foundation. We hope to help fund research to fight this devastating disease and we hope to help families take advantage of the good times during treatment. Dear Friends and Family,

This will be the last time that I will post on this website. We now have the catiehochfoundation.org website up and running and I will start to write on that site.

It has been a very busy year. Johnny and Robby are both playing soccer and are busy with other sports and school events so they keep us running. The Catie Hoch Foundation continues to thrive.

The third annual Catiebug for a Cure was a tremendous success with over 400 there. We raised over $17,000 and raised community awareness.

We had a Fall Family Festival at Clifton Park Center which was a wonderful way to see people in the community. We had a great time!

Our latest fund-raiser was a luncheon at the Outback Restaurant in Clifton Park. I was approached by the proprietor because she wanted to help a children's charity. All of the proceeds went to the foundation. We sold out (225 tickets) and raised over $4,500.

Now for the BIG news... JK Rowling - the Harry Potter author who befriended Catie has touched our lives once again. Not only did she have a wonderful relationship with Catie - e-mails, presents and phone calls, she now made a $100,000 donation to the Catie Hoch Foundation. I'm still not sure how it happened since I never asked her for money. I always felt that she did so much for Catie and all of us.

I want to wish you all a Happy Thanksgiving. We are heading off to Florida to see my parents and spend some time at the ocean. Thanks to all of you who continue to support our family and Catie's Foundation.

Love, Gina
